Your site seems rather low on text for the spiders to analyze, adding some articles would help them categorize the site. I don’t see evidence of your seo efforts, yahoo site explorer reports a total of 2 inlinks, from Seema Blogs. It can take months for search engines to actually credit your site for some links. Being so image intensive, you should try harder to get into the search image indexes, while providing lower quality traffic, it still might be worth adding alt text (now missing) and perhaps longer file names containing key word.

If it were my site I would do the following:
1. Try to decrease the amount of code used throughout the site as much as possible
2. Use google keyword tool to narrow in and determine a few key terms per page (I personally try to stay with 2 – 3 per page) Once you have done this make sure to utilize those terms in navigation throughout the site as well as within your content
3. This appears to be an affiliate site which most likely means your advertising budget is limited. I would go ahead and perform a link check on your top competitors to see where they are advertising.
You can do this by going to Google and typing link:www.competitorsurl.com
I believe this will offer some valuable information on your next steps as well.

2. Blogs. Find other blogs that are related to your niche and visit them. These blogs have places to leave comments where you can include your website. Just be sure you make a legitimate comment and don’t just spam different blogs or the link building will not be effective.
3. Forums. Find forums related to your niche and get involved. Start reading posts, answering questions and asking them. Be sure to set up you signature file so that each time you get involved your website will be left behind which builds many backlinks.
4. Videos. Google owns You Tube and they rank videos very highly on their search engine. When you submit a video you can link it back to your website. This gives you a very good backlink and can give you some very good traffic as well.
5. Reciprocal linking. Trading links still works as well. You put their link in your resource directory and they repay the favor by putting yours in their directory.
The key is to keep the link relevant to the theme of your site. Search engines like it this way and so do your visitors. Trading links is very easy to do.
